DescriptionHosted simple database service by Amazon, with the data stored in the Amazon Cloud. infoThere is an unrelated product called SimpleDB developed by Edward ScioreOpen-source analytics data store designed for sub-second OLAP queries on high dimensionality and high cardinality dataAnalytics Platform for Big DataTiDB is an open source distributed SQL database that supports Hybrid Transactional/Analytical Processing (HTAP) workloads. It is MySQL compatible and features horizontal scalability, strong consistency, and high availability.Fast distributed SQL query engine for big data analytics. Forked from Presto and originally named PrestoSQL
